Abstract

A foldable electronic device includes a first lid and a second lid rotatably coupled together by a hinge. A first inertial measurement unit (IMU) is implemented in the first lid and generates first sensor data. A second IMU is implemented in the second lid and generates second sensor data. A sensor processing unit detects the rotation angle between the first and second lids and generates rotated second sensor data by adjusting the second sensor data based on the rotation angle. The sensor processing unit generates combined sensor data by combining the first sensor data with the rotated second sensor data. The combined sensor data is more accurate than either the first sensor data or the second sensor data.

Claims (47)

1 . A method, comprising:

generating first sensor data with a first inertial measurement unit in a first lid of a foldable electronic device;

generating second sensor data with a second inertial measurement unit in a second lid of the foldable electronic device;

detecting a rotation angle between the first lid and the second lid based on the first and second sensor data;

generating rotated second sensor data by adjusting the second sensor data based on the rotation angle; and

generating combined sensor data by combining the first sensor data and the rotated second sensor data.

2 . The method of claim 1 , wherein adjusting the second sensor data includes applying to the second sensor data a rotation matrix based on the rotation angle.

3 . The method of claim 1 , comprising:

generating a first accuracy value based on the first and second sensor data; and

generating the combined sensor data based on the first accuracy value.

4 . The method of claim 3 , comprising generating an angle change value indicating how fast the rotation angle is changing.

5 . The method of claim 4 , comprising:

generating the combined sensor data if the angle change value is less than a threshold value; and

stopping generation of the combined sensor data if the angle change value is greater than or equal to the threshold value.

6 . The method of claim 3 , comprising generating a second accuracy value for the combined sensor based on the angle change value.

7 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the first sensor data includes first accelerometer data and first gyroscope data, while the second sensor data includes second accelerometer data and second gyroscope data.

8 . The method of claim 7 , wherein the combined sensor data includes combined accelerometer data and combined gyroscope data.

9 . The method of claim 1 , wherein generating combined sensor data includes averaging the first sensor data and the rotated second sensor data.

10 . The method of claim 1 , wherein generating combined sensor data includes:

applying a first weight to the first sensor data based on a noise level of the rotated second sensor data;

applying a second weight to the rotated second sensor data based on a noise level of the first sensor data; and

generating a weighted average of the first sensor data and second sensor data based on the first weight and the second weight.
